What companies run services between Bodegraven, Netherlands and Germany?

You can take a train from Bodegraven to S+U Alexanderplatz Bhf via Utrecht Centraal, Hengelo, and Berlin Hbf in around 6h 48m.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Utrecht Central Station to Berlin, Zentralen Omnibusbahnhof 5 times a week. Tickets cost €30–70 and the journey takes 7h 25m.
